原标题:前端页面制作代码里的SEO注意事项
页面代码,以于SEO来说是非常重要的,因为这是搜索引擎能识别的页面内容,所以有很多需要注意的点,总结下来,大家一起看看:
SEO前端代码知识
1、 DIV+CSS:
1) 代码要清晰,DIV层次不要太深,一般不超过3级嵌套为佳;
2) 用CSS控制显示长度,不要用程序控制获取的;
3) 代码里不要出现直接写的样式style=””;
4) CSS文件不要太多,尽量合并在一起,减少http请求,如样式文件特别大,可分开处理;
5) 尽量把主要内容写在代码靠前的位置,如遇页面左右结构,主要内容在左侧,可用样式控制代码里右侧在前,以让搜索引擎更容易抓取到主要内容;
6) 背景图标合并,减少http请求次数,一次加载,完成所有背景图标,提高页面访问速度;
2、 Table:
1) 如非特殊需求尽量都不使用;
2) 如一定要使用,表格嵌套控制在3层以内;
3、 H标签:
1) 除首页以外,每个页面需要有且仅有1个h1标签,且标签里含有页面主关键词;
2) 首页可以没有h1标签,主频道版块标题均为h2标签,含频道关键词,次级栏目用h3标签,再次用h4;
3) 频道首页有h1标签,主栏目用h2标签,次级栏目用h3;
4) 栏目列表页,h1标签,含栏目关键词,无h2标签,相关版块均为h3标签;
5) 内容页,h1标签为文章标题,无h2标签,相关版块均为h3标签;
6) 专题页,h1标签为专题名称,含关键词,需要后续设计专题时留出专题文字位置;
注:注意样式控制字体显示的大小,在同一个页面里,h1 > h2 > h3 > h4 > h5,理论上不控制h标签的字号大小为最佳。
4、 ALT属性:
Alt属性,非背景类图片,均需要添加,标准为:图片内容 或者 关键词+图片内容
5、 加粗:
Strong > b > css ,即strong标签优于b标签,优于用css样式写出来的加粗效果;
6、 空格:
尽量不要用 ,可以用样式来控制,或者用全角的空格;
7、 Title、Keywords、Description:
此3者为一个整体,而且优先顺序一定要是Title、Keywords、Description的顺序,目前问题比较严重的,参看一下tiebaobei的页面,顺序不对,而且没有在一起;
8、 标签完整性:
即标签要保持完整性,有结束符,否则影响页面质量;
检测工具:http://tools.aizhan.com/?r=htmlcheck
9、 Nofollow:
页面底部footer里面的链接,如关于我们,联系我们等,可加此标签,以避免权重流失到这些页面,另外,在广告代码中,如是直接链接到对方网站的地址,也需要添加此标签;
10、 URL:
1) 统一性:
即一个页面的地址表现形式,只有一种,如多种链接都可以访问到同一个页面,就需要全部统一到某一种,以避免权重分散,也可避免搜索引擎的重复页面惩罚;
如:http://bbs.xxxxxx.com/
http://bbs.xxxxxx.com/forum.php
需要统一成:http://bbs.xxxxxx.com/ 需要技术在服务上配置
2) 唯一性:
此要求,一个页面只有唯一的一个地址可以访问,不能出现多个域名下均可以访问到同一个页面,只是路径不一样的情况,再有就是动态与伪静态地址的统一,对外只能显示静态化的地址;
11、 JS:
1) 页面代码里,尽量不要包含大段的JS代码,以影响整个页面的大小,影响搜索引擎抓取;
2) 如果JS代码只能写在代码里才生效的情况,看是否可以把js代码放到代码最底部;
3) Js文件合并,减少http请求,提高页面访问速度;
12、 其他:
其他待补充细节,随时补充。返回搜狐,查看更多
责任编辑: